Setting IP Address Setting Print Status Sheet Restore Settings Options Auto Panel Print Yes No Description Determines whether IP addresses are obtained automatically through DHCP or manually. Select Panel to enter an IP address, subnet mask, and default gateway address. Prints the current network status and settings Restores all items in the Network Setup menu to their default settings Parent topic: Using the Control Panel Menus Preference Menu Settings The Preference menu specifies language and other settings for the printer's controls. Setting Date And Time Language Unit: Length Unit: Temperature Alert Sound Setting Alert Lamp Setting Options MM/DD/YY HH:MM Various languages m ft/in °C °F On Off On Off Description Sets the printer's built-in clock. The time and date are used in logs and status sheets. Selects the language used on the control panel display. Selects the unit of length used on the control panel display and when printing test patterns Selects the temperature units used on the control panel display Enables the alert sound when an error occurs. Press the OK button to turn off the sound. Enables the alert light when an error occurs. 77
